Though teens are an enigma to many adults, they are the consumers of tomorrow — heads of households and holders of the family purse who will make the decisions and shape the habits and attitudes of yet another, even newer generation. With enormous potential buying power and influence, we may believe we don’t understand this group, but what we do know about them offers great potential to vegetarian food businesses.

Selling doesn’t just take place in the aisles of grocery stores anymore. Those days are long gone — in fact, selling is often taking place on laptops, on cell phones, and most recently, on iPads! A new study from Nielsen finds that the world spends over 110 billion minutes on social media networks and blog sites, which is equal to 2% of all time spent online or one in every four and a half minutes spent online per user.

In today’s marketplace, engaging with customers and potential customers goes well beyond coupons and newspaper ads. In fact, today, many consumers actually invite businesses into their lives through social media. More commonly known as Facebook, Twitter, and a score of other upcoming platforms, businesses can now interact directly and publicly with a nearly infinite number of potential customers, making it critically important to establish and define a sound set of guidelines and procedures by which your business will engage with consumers.
